Liuyishou Fondue is widely praised for its authentic hot pot experience, featuring fresh ingredients and a standout make-your-own sauce bar. Many customers appreciate the generous portions, friendly service, and lively atmosphere, making it a popular choice for both newcomers to hot pot and seasoned enthusiasts.
